Implementar um ambiente seguro para um serviço de base de dados

Implemente opções baseadas no SQL Server para autenticação e autorização, bem como opções no Azure para proteger bases de dados SQL do Azure. Explore encriptação, firewalls e proteção avançada contra ameaças.

Pré-requisitos

  • Ter a capacidade de utilizar ferramentas para executar consultas a uma base de dados SQL da Microsoft, no local ou com base na cloud
  • Compreender por que motivo a segurança é uma parte crucial do planeamento de sistemas de bases de dados
  • Ter a capacidade de escrever código na linguagem SQL, particularmente no dialeto T-SQL da Microsoft, a um nível básico.
  • Ter experiência na criação e configuração de recursos com o portal do Azure

Introdução ao Azure

Escolha a conta do Azure correta para si. Pague à medida que avança ou experimente o Azure gratuitamente até 30 dias. Inscrição.

Módulos neste percurso de aprendizagem

Compare a autenticação com Microsoft Entra ID e a autenticação do SQL Server. Implemente várias entidades de segurança e configure permissões.

Explore as opções de criptografia disponíveis no Azure SQL, incluindo regras de firewall, Always Encrypted e Transport Layer Security. Entenda como funciona a injeção de SQL.

Explore os recursos de classificação de dados e os graus de confidencialidade. Implemente opções de segurança para manter os dados privados seguros, incluindo auditoria SQL do Azure, Microsoft Defender for SQL, segurança em nível de linha, mascaramento dinâmico de dados e livro-razão.